What is a remote document controller?

A Remote Document Controller is a professional responsible for managing, organizing, and maintaining documents and records for a company or project, all while working remotely. They ensure that documents are properly stored, updated, and accessible to authorized personnel, often following strict protocols and version control systems. This role is essential in industries like construction, engineering, oil and gas, and legal services, where accurate documentation is critical for compliance and project management. Remote Document Controllers use specialized software to track documents, collaborate with team members, and maintain confidentiality and data security.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a remote document controller?

To thrive as a Remote Document Controller,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ience with document management practices, often supported by a relevant degree or certification. Familiarity with document control software such as SharePoint, Aconex, or EDMS platforms is typically required. Exceptional communication, time management, and the ability to work independently are valuable soft skills in this remote role. These abilities ensure accurate, secure, and efficient handling of critical documents, supporting project success and compliance in distributed teams.

How does a remote document controller collaborate with project teams and ensure document accuracy while working offsite?

As a Remote Document Controller, you will regularly interact with project managers, engineers, and other stakeholders through digital collaboration tools like document management systems, email, and video conferencing. Maintaining version control and ensuring document accuracy can be challenging without face-to-face interactions, so strong organizational skills and proactive communication are crucial. You’ll often be responsible for setting up document workflows, tracking approvals, and conducting audits to guarantee compliance with company standards. Building effective remote relationships and staying responsive to team needs are key to success in this role.

Position: Senior Corporate ControllerCompany: Investment Real Estate CompanyLocation: (remote) - based in AustinCompensation: up to $215,000 totalReports: 2 (active mentorship)Growth: Significant acceleration in core business expected plus new income stream upon new product launch.The Senior Corporate Controller is responsible for end-to-end accounting, financial reporting, controls, tax, investor reporting, and day-to-day treasury for the corporate entity and lending portfolios. The right person will serve as senior finance leader, mentor to a small accounting team, and partner to operations, origination, legal and the executive team.Responsibilities:
  • Lead month-end, quarter-end, and year-end close for corporate and fund/portfolio entities; prepare consolidated GAAP financial statements.
  • Oversee loan accounting (origination, interest accruals,fees,servicing,payoffs),impairment/allowance for credit losses, charge-offs and loss reserves in accordance with ASC guidance.
  • Manage investor reporting (monthly/quarterly statements, waterfalls calculations, capital account reconciliations, K-1 coordination).
  • Prepare and deliver timely financial packages, KPI dashboards and cash forecasts to executive leadership and investors.
  • Drive external audit and tax engagements; prepare schedules and respond to auditor/taxrequests.
  • Design, document, and maintain internal controls, policies and SOX-lite procedures appropriate to company size and regulatory requirements.
  • Oversee treasury: cash management, bank relationships, loan funding mechanics, debt covenants and compliance.
  • Implement and optimize accounting systems and automation (ERP, loan management system integrations) and lead system migrations/upgrades.
  • Manage, develop and mentor a small accounting team (2-6 direct reports); coordinate with operations for reconciliations and processes.
  • Support pricing, capital raise diligence, and ad hoc financial modeling for acquisitions, securitizations, or new product launches.
Must-Haves:
  • CPA or equivalent professional accounting credential strongly preferred.
  • 8+ years of progressive accounting experience; minimum 3-5 years in a controller/senior accounting leadership role.
  • Direct experience with private lending/hard-money, mortgage/loan accounting, or commercial real-estate finance strongly preferred.
  • Deep knowledge of US GAAP, consolidation, revenue recognition, allowance methodologies, and audit/tax processes.
  • Hands-on experience with investor reporting (K-1, waterfall models) and fund accounting.
  • Strong Excel modeling skills; familiarity with ERPs and loan servicing or loan management systems (e.g., Sage Intacct).
  • Exceptional attention to detail, process orientation, and ability to work in a fast-paced environment.
Like-to-Haves:
  • Familiarity with ASC 326 (CECL) and ASC 310.
  • Experience scaling finance functions and implementing automation.
What Success Looks Like:
  • Timely and accurate monthly close (≤5-7 business days).
  • Clean external audits with minimal adjustments and timely tax filings.
  • Accurate investor distributions and reporting deadlines met 100%
  • Reduction in manual reconciliation time via automation initiatives.
  • Effective cash forecasting within ±5% variance.
